## Partner SFTP Drop — Marlowe Freight

Files land nightly between 02:00–03:30 UTC in the inbound drop. Watcher job `marlowe-ingest` picks them up; if nothing arrives by 04:00, the Quillhook alert fires. Do NOT re-request files from Marlowe before checking the quarantine folder — malformed headers get parked there silently. Retries are safe; ingest is idempotent on file checksum. Rotation of the drop credentials is quarterly, owned by platform. Full escalation steps and contacts are on the runbook page.

dashboard of taduf-tahof = https://confluence.tolvaqlabs.internal/browse/browse/display/f01240ca

Hey Tomas — handing off the flaky DNS thing on Glimmerhost. Short version for plugin authors: resolution intermittently fails inside the sandbox because the stub resolver caches negative answers way too long. Workaround is retry with jitter; real fix lands next sprint. Don't hardcode IPs in your plugins, please. The resolver currently runs with the following settings:

deployment values, yadup-kadug:
[sorys]
port = 5672
team = noveth
host = sorys.orvexcorp.example
region = south-4
access_code = ac_deddc1
timeout_ms = 1500

## Runbook: GPU Memory Profiling with Memlens

When a customer reports out-of-memory crashes on Tesselgrid workers, spin up Memlens before asking them to downsize batches — nine times out of ten it's fragmentation, not actual exhaustion. Memlens attaches to the worker process and samples allocations; it's cheap enough to leave running for an hour. Don't enable full stack capture in prod, it's brutal. Start the profiler with these settings.

config for yafog-bajef:
istiel:
  pin: 5156
  tenant: wenys
  seal: seal_c3c32daa
  metrics_host: metrics.istiel.torvadyn.example
  standby_team: eliir
  escalation: norael-drudor
  nonce: 18482d

**CI note: kiosk watchdog flaking on Orbix runners.** The Pavilion kiosk app's watchdog test intermittently fails because the simulated heartbeat thread starts before the display stub is ready, so the watchdog reboots the session mid-assertion. Workaround: rerun the `watchdog-soak` stage once; a proper startup barrier lands next sprint. If it fails twice consecutively, page the kiosk team. When filing, include the failing run's build token below.

trace token, fafog-kageg: htk4_98e6